The cancer diagnosis cost
The cost of a cancer diagnosis is a complex and often daunting aspect of dealing with this serious disease. While the emotional and physical toll of cancer is well documented, the financial burden can be equally overwhelming for patients and their families. Understanding the various components that contribute to the overall cost of diagnosing cancer is essential for patients, healthcare providers, and policymakers aiming to mitigate financial stress and improve access to care.
Initially, the diagnostic process involves a series of tests and procedures, each with its associated costs. These typically include blood tests, imaging studies such as X-rays, CT scans, MRI scans, PET scans, and biopsies. The choice and number of tests depend on the suspected type and stage of cancer, which can vary widely. Advanced imaging techniques, while highly effective in detecting and staging tumors, tend to be more expensive and may not be accessible to all patients, especially in underserved regions.
Laboratory analysis and pathology services are also critical components of diagnosis. Once a biopsy is performed, tissue samples are examined microscopically to confirm the presence of cancer cells, determine the type of cancer, and assess its aggressiveness. These analyses require specialized expertise and equipment, contributing further to the overall cost. The turnaround time for results can influence the timeline and urgency of subsequent treatment plans, adding another layer of complexity.
Beyond the direct costs of tests, there are indirect expenses related to the diagnostic process, including transportation, accommodation (particularly if specialized centers are far from the patient’s home), and time off work. These ancillary costs can significantly add to the financial strain, especially for patients in rural or low-income settings.
Insurance coverage plays a pivotal role in determining out-of-pocket expenses. In many countries, comprehensive health insurance can substantially reduce the financial burden, covering most diagnostic procedures. However, coverage varies widely, and gaps often exist, leaving patients to bear a significant portion of costs. In regions with limited healthcare coverage or where out-of-pocket payments are prevalent, the cost of diagnosis can be prohibitively high, sometimes leading to delayed diagnosis or deferred testing altogether.
Furthermore, the costs associated with diagnosis are influenced by healthcare infrastructure and regional economic factors. Developed countries generally have more advanced diagnostic facilities and higher associated costs, but also often better coverage options. In contrast, developing countries may face challenges such as limited access to high-tech imaging or pathology services, which can delay diagnosis and increase the long-term costs of treatment.
The financial implications of a cancer diagnosis extend beyond immediate testing. Delays or barriers in diagnosis can lead to later-stage discoveries, which are more complicated and expensive to treat. This underscores the importance of accessible, affordable, and timely diagnostic services to improve patient outcomes and reduce economic hardship.
